Startseite
  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Themes & Theming ›

Welches Base-Theme benutzt ihr?

Eingetragen von missingdot (145)
am 04.02.2014 - 12:48 Uhr in
  • Themes & Theming
  • Drupal 7.x oder neuer

Hallo zusammen,

der Titel sagt eigentlich schon alles. Ich wollte mal rumfragen mit welchen Base-Theme ihr arbeitet!? Habe bislang mit Omega 3 gearbeitet und würde aber gerne wechseln.

Vielen Dank für eure Rückmeldungen.

‹ Function über preprocess/template.php anpassen Override eines bestimmten Imagefield 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Ich fange meist mit einem von

Eingetragen von wla (9461)
am 04.02.2014 - 13:18 Uhr

Ich fange meist mit einem von Zen abgeleiteten Sub-Theme an. Zen ist aktuell responsive und unterstützt Sass/Compass, was einem die Arbeit beim CSS doch sehr erleichtert.

Beste Grüße
Werner

  • Anmelden oder Registrieren um Kommentare zu schreiben

Hab mir das mal angeschaut

Eingetragen von missingdot (145)
am 04.02.2014 - 15:09 Uhr

Hab mir das mal angeschaut und werde es mal ausprobieren. Ist aber schon eine extreme Umstellung zu Omega... ;)

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ich nutze bislang

Eingetragen von maen (547)
am 05.02.2014 - 11:12 Uhr

Ich nutze bislang AdaptiveTheme und baue daraus dann mittels Subtheming was immer ich möchte.
Aber mal eine andere Frage:

Grundsätzlich kenne ich die Vorgehensweise mittels SASS/COMPASS. Was sich mir aber bisher nicht erschließ ist der Vorteil des Konstruktes.

Mein Gegenargument:
Jede Seite sollte so schmal wie möglich sein, und noch ein RUBY Programm um CSS zu erstellen / interpretieren erscheint mir gefühlt als Overkill.
Könnte mich evtl. jemand dahin motivieren dies trotzdem einzusetzen?

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ich habe Compass auf der

Eingetragen von wla (9461)
am 05.02.2014 - 11:34 Uhr

Ich habe Compass auf der lokalen Entwicklungsumgebung laufen. Compass generiert aus einem strukturierten und besser lesbaren scss-File den eingesetzen CSS-File. Vor allem die Möglichkeit CSS-Snippets zu definieren, die bei Bedarf nur angezogen werden, ergibt eine bessere Lesbarkeit. Auch die Strukturen kann ich leichter sehen. Außerdem werden die CSS3-Befehle zusätzlich durch browserspezifische Konstrukte ergänzt, ohne daß ich mich darum kümmern müsste. Ein paar Beispiele:

/**
*  kalender navigation
*/
.cal-nav-wrapper {
  width: 100%;
  text-align: center;
 
  .cal-nav {

    .cal-pager {
      margin: 10px 0;
      width: 530px;
      display: inline-flex;
     
      span {
        @include horizontal-list-item(0, 'left');
        width: 150px;
       
        &.cal-prev {
          text-align: left;
        }
        &.date-heading {
          margin: 0 40px;
          text-align: center;
         
            h3 {
              margin: 0;
            }
          }
        &.cal-next {
          text-align: right;
        }
      }
    }
  }
}

Zeigt den strukturierten Aufbau, @include horizontal-list-item(0, 'left'); bringt eine Liste automatisch in eine horizontale Ausrichtung.
/**
*  Default Block Definition
*/
%block {
  padding: 19px;
  margin-bottom: 20px;
  background-color: $wblauhg;
  border: $wrand 1px solid;
  @include border-radius(5px);
 
  > h2 {
    font-family: $bree;
    color: $wgelb;
    font-size: 20px;
    line-height: 1em;
    font-weight: 700;
    margin-bottom: 20px;
    }
}

#block-block-9 {
  @extend %block;
}
/*
*  Seiten-Menü
*/
.block-menu-block {
  @extend %block;
 
  ul {
    padding-left: 20px;
  }
 
  li.active-trail {
    color: $wgelb;
  }
}
/**
*    Map Block
*/
#block-block-17 {
  @extend %block;
  min-height: 420px;
}

Eine einmal gemachte CSS-Definition für Blöcke wird einfach angezogen und steht in der endgültigen CSS-Datei auch nur noch einmal drin mit einer Reihe verschiedenster Selektoren davor. Ebenso ist hier zu sehen, daß man mit Variablen (hier für Farben) arbeiten kann. Ich habe den Farbwert an einer Stelle definiert und sollte er sich einmal ändern, muß ich es nur an einer Stelle tun.

Es gibt viele Automatismen in Compass, die ich nicht mehr missen möchte. Auch ein Arbeiten mit Sprites ist super einfach. Der Zeitaufwand für die Einarbeitung rechnet sich sehr schnell.

Beste Grüße
Werner

  • Anmelden oder Registrieren um Kommentare zu schreiben

heißt das demnach Du

Eingetragen von maen (547)
am 05.02.2014 - 11:43 Uhr

heißt das demnach Du verwendest compass/sass zur Konstruktion aber produktiv die generierten CSS Dateien?

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ja, genau so. Beste

Eingetragen von wla (9461)
am 05.02.2014 - 12:52 Uhr

Ja, genau so.

Beste Grüße
Werner

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zt Du git mit github?

Eingetragen von maria-rita (504)
am 23.09.2014 - 18:48 Uhr

Hallo Werner,

wie bringst Du die Dateien dann auf den Produktivserver? Per FTP oder nutzt Du dazu Git mit Github oder Bitbucket?

Viele Grüße

Marita

  • Anmelden oder Registrieren um Kommentare zu schreiben

Welcher hoster liefert denn

Eingetragen von maen (547)
am 23.09.2014 - 18:53 Uhr

Welcher hoster liefert denn git oder bitbucket? Das geht doch nur wenn du Deinen Hoster selbst baust. Ich gehe davon aus, der Werner macht das traditionell mit der Schubkarre. Wie alle ehrlichen Arbeiter ;)

  • Anmelden oder Registrieren um Kommentare zu schreiben

Das Hochladen der CSS-Dateien

Eingetragen von wla (9461)
am 23.09.2014 - 19:55 Uhr

Das Hochladen der CSS-Dateien mach ich über FTP. Auch wenn ich später noch mal am CSS basten muß, mach ich das immer lokal mit Sass/Compass und schiebe dann die neue CSS-Datei auf den Server. Ich habe ohnehin von allen Webseiten, die ich betreue, eine lokale Kopie.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Compass & SASS - nutzen!

Eingetragen von SuperEngineer 64 (133)
am 28.09.2014 - 08:12 Uhr

Compass & SASS - nutzen! :)

Schon allein der Vorteil Variablen nutzen zu können, die du mit einer Farbe/Eigenschaft befüllst, mehrfach aufrufst und nur an einer Stelle dann ändern musst ist super.

Als Theme nutze ich Tao. Das Theme bringt (fast) keine vordefinierten CSS-Regeln und resettet sogut wie alles was ausm Drupal-Core kommt.

  • Anmelden oder Registrieren um Kommentare zu schreiben

also zen war bei mir immer

Eingetragen von caw (2762)
am 29.09.2014 - 06:26 Uhr

also zen war bei mir immer fehlerbahftet (hat alle menüklassen entfernt)
ich nutze adaptive und nucleus. zurb ist auch gut, aber ebenso wie bootstrap überladen...

  • Anmelden oder Registrieren um Kommentare zu schreiben

Omega 4

Eingetragen von JThan (396)
am 29.09.2014 - 13:58 Uhr

Omega 4

  • Anmelden oder Registrieren um Kommentare zu schreiben

Mothership und Tao

Eingetragen von howdytom (176)
am 30.09.2014 - 12:54 Uhr

Mothership und Tao

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• für drupal11 ein Slider Modul
  • [gelöst] W3CSS Paragraphs Views
  • Drupal 11 neu aufsetzen und Bereiche aus 10 importieren
  • Wie erlaubt man neuen Benutzern auf die Resetseite zugreifen zu dürfen.
  • [gelöst] Anzeigeformat Text mit Bild in einem Artikel, Drupal 11
  • Social Media Buttons um Insteragram erweitern
  • Nach Installation der neuesten D10-Version kein Zugriff auf Website
  • Composer nach Umzug
  • [gelöst] Taxonomie Begriffe zeigt nicht alle Nodes an
  • Drupal 11 + Experience Builder (Canvas) + Layout Builder
  • Welche KI verwendet ihr?
  • Update Manger läst sich nicht Installieren
Weiter

Neue Kommentare

  • melde mich mal wieder, da ich
    vor 4 Tagen 3 Stunden
  • Hey danke
    vor 4 Tagen 21 Stunden
  • Update: jetzt gibt's ein
    vor 5 Tagen 15 Stunden
  • Hallo, im Prinzip habe ich
    vor 1 Woche 3 Tagen
  • Da scheint die Terminologie
    vor 1 Woche 3 Tagen
  • Kannst doch auch alles direkt
    vor 2 Wochen 10 Stunden
  • In der entsprechenden View
    vor 2 Wochen 10 Stunden
  • Dazu müsstest Du vermutlich
    vor 2 Wochen 10 Stunden
  • gelöst
    vor 4 Wochen 4 Tagen
  • Ja natürlich. Dass ist etwas,
    vor 4 Wochen 4 Tagen

Statistik

Beiträge im Forum: 250233
Registrierte User: 20449

Neue User:

  • Mroppoofpaync
  • 4aficiona2
  • AppBuilder

» Alle User anzeigen

User nach Punkten sortiert:
wla9461
stBorchert6003
quiptime4972
Tobias Bähr4019
bv3924
ronald3857
md3717
Thoor3678
Alexander Langer3416
Exterior2903
» User nach Punkten
Zur Zeit sind 0 User und 10 Gäste online.

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Forum
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association